(VB.NET) Compress XML TreeDemonstrates how to compress and restore the entire subtree rooted at an XML node. The input XML, available at http://www.chilkatsoft.com/data/compress2.xml, is this:
<root>
<lazydog>
<fox>The quick brown fox jumps over the lazy dog</fox>
</lazydog>
<fox>The quick brown fox jumps over the lazy dog</fox>
<child>
<grandchild>The quick brown fox jumps over the lazy dog</grandchild>
</child>
<child>
<grandchild>The quick brown fox jumps over the lazy dog</grandchild>
</child>
</root>
Download: Chilkat .NET Assemblies Dim xml As New Chilkat.Xml() Dim success As Boolean ' The sample input XML is available at http://www.chilkatsoft.com/data/compress2.xml success = xml.LoadXmlFile("compress2.xml") If (success <> true) Then TextBox1.Text = TextBox1.Text & xml.LastErrorText & vbCrLf Exit Sub End If ' Zip compress the root node's entire subtree: xml.ZipTree() ' Examine the new XML document: TextBox1.Text = TextBox1.Text & xml.GetXml() & vbCrLf ' This is the XML w/ the compressed subtree in Base64 encoded format: '<root><![CDATA[4+WyKcrPL7Hj5VIAApucxKrKlPx0KBcslJZfYReSkapQWJqZnK2QVJRfnqcAFFPIKs0tKFbIL0st UigBSoN0KgC12uiDNECN00c1jyKzkjMyc1KQHZZelJiXAhElyUwkfTBnovDoYZGNPjTUAQ== ]]></root>' Now uncompress and show that the original subtree was restored: xml.UnzipTree() TextBox1.Text = TextBox1.Text & xml.GetXml() & vbCrLf |
